Double-coated breeds (German Shepherds, Samoyeds, Malamutes) possess a soft, dense undercoat beneath a coarser topcoat. During shedding seasons, loose fur can exceed a pound per session. Standard tubs fail in three ways:
Drain clogging within 5 minutes of washing.
Inadequate water pressure to penetrate the undercoat.
Poor ergonomics forcing groomers to bend excessively, leading to fatigue.
